Poppy acrylic print by Bonnie Young. Bring your artwork to life with the stylish lines and added depth of an acrylic print. Your image gets printed directly onto the back of a 1/4" thick sheet of clear acrylic. The high gloss of the acrylic sheet complements the rich colors of any image to produce stunning results. Artist's Description
My childhood home was simple, but Mom decorated it with her many touches, love. Outside the front door amidst the cracks in the old sidewalk grew giant red poppies.
I ask her how she was able to get them to grow, and she would say, “Simple. Just toss the seeds and walk on by.”
I tried that, and it did not work for me. I dug some of Mom’s plants and took them home to transplant in my yard. They did not grow. I bought plants at the garden center. After Twenty-eight years, I was able to have one successful plant. Two years later, before it bloomed, we moved away.
Mom passed away in 2013. I miss both Mom and her poppies.
The painting is watercolor on Arches 140 pound Cold-Pressed paper.

About Bonnie Young
Bonnie Young connects to rural life and landscape because they reflect her roots. She discovered the love of painting the light and shadows and their effects on her subjects as she studied nature. For her, painting is an artistic articulation of life captured in watercolor or digital creations. Watercolor allows her to build depth and detail through layering glazes. While still attending elementary school in a one room schoolhouse in the Nebraska Sandhills, she began painting. For most of her adult life, she lived in the midwest and west. She studied art at Kansas State University, the Canton Museum of Art in Canton, Ohio, and the Arvada Center for the Arts and Humanities, Colorado.
